Sofia is the capital and largest city of Bulgaria. With a population of approximately 1.3 million residents, Sofia is the country’s principal political, economic, cultural, and educational centre. Through its administration, the Sofia City Council, Sofia delivers a broad range of public social services aimed at supporting vulnerable residents.
